or have your idler and Pittman arms inspected for signs of wear. Alignment issues an inability to set the proper alignment for your vehicle may indicate worn steering arms. Since the idler arms and Pittman arms are exposed to similar wear conditions, you should replace the steering arms at the same time.
Exposure to dirt, road salt, and other harsh road conditions can cause wear and tear on your steering arms, or cause connections to loosen. Uneven tire wear worn steering arms may result in uneven tire wear. difficulty loss of steering responsiveness, wandering steering while driving at speed, or a shimmy in the front end of your vehicle may indicate worn steering arms.
. One way to test your steering arm assemblies is to try to turn the steering wheel while your vehicle is parked.
